Output 24eadea3ce712123399aac259bd29772f3aa8909b71cb94a757d9215c3cb16ac:1

value
574368
script pubkey
OP_0 OP_PUSHBYTES_20 44bb60beb9995c957ac4f3b40b0e32f515df63ec
address
tb1qgjakp04en9wf27ky7w6qkr3j752a7clvayymg0
transaction
24eadea3ce712123399aac259bd29772f3aa8909b71cb94a757d9215c3cb16ac
confirmations
106627
spent
false

1 Sat Range